Claims
- 1. Apparatus for concurrently making two axially spaced cuts on an elongated bar stock type workpiece, comprising, in combination:
- a. chuck means for grasping a portion of said workpiece;
- b. an elongated support underlying the portion of said workpiece projecting outwardly from said chuck means;
- c. a pair of annular cutters having cutting teeth formed on their inner annuli;
- d. a sleeve secured to each said annular cutter;
- e. a pair of sleeve supports adjustable mounted on said elongated support and respectively journalling said sleeves for rotation about the workpiece length axis with both sleeves and cutters surrounding the projecting end of said workpiece;
- f. means for concurrently rotating said sleeves; and
- g. means for concurrently moving said sleeve supports transversely relative to said workpiece to produce two cuts therein spaced according to the longitudinal spacing of said sleeve supports.
- 2. The combination defined in claim 1 wherein said sleeve supports are respectively moved in opposite transverse directions so that the annular cutters are concurrently engaging opposite sides of said workpiece.
- 3. The combination defined in claim 1 wherein a workpiece support is disposed between said sleeve supports to support the one severed length of the workpiece on completion of said cutting operation.
